+There is the possibility that ``dummy thread objects'' are created.
+These are thread objects corresponding to ``alien threads'', which
+are threads of control started outside the threading module, such as
+directly from C code. Dummy thread objects have limited
+functionality; they are always considered alive and daemonic, and
+cannot be \method{join()}ed. They are never deleted, since it is
+impossible to detect the termination of alien threads.
